Assaults on journalists must be punished severely: association

Vo Minh Chau, a reporter of Tien Phong newspaper, at the hospital after being assaulted by two men using helmets and knives

The Vietnam Journalists Association has called for severe punishments for those involved in the attacks on three local reporters on Wednesday.

The two consecutive assaults on journalists have upset the journalistic fraternity and the public, Le Quoc Trung, deputy chairman of the association, told Thanh Nien on Friday.

“We condemn any physical aggression against journalists and we request strict penalties,” Trung said, noting that Prime Minister Nguyen Tan Dung has also ordered strict punishment against the culprits in both cases.

Nguoi Lao Dong reporter Tran The Dung was beaten by a group of men while he was taking photos for a report on poultry smuggling in the northern province of Lang Son, bordering China.

After the assault, the attackers drove Dung to a local police station, challenging him to seek police help, he said. Dung was later taken to Lang Son Hospital as he had suffered multiple injuries on the whole body including his face.

Two of the attackers were identified on Friday, including the man who drove Dung to the police station.

Also on Wednesday, two reporters of Tien Phong newspaper, Vo Minh Chau and Pham Minh Thuy, were assaulted by two men using helmets and knives. The reporters were reporting on the enforcement of an administrative order on land use in the central province of Ha Tinh’s Ky Tho Commune.

Chau, 60, is still hospitalized in Hanoi.

Police said they were investigating both cases.

Nguyen Van Trach, deputy editor in chief of Nguoi Lao Dong newspaper, said assaults on journalists are no longer rare as there were many such incidents last year.

If the attackers are not punished strictly, it would hurt the confidence of journalists, Trach said, asking for more protection for reporters and media personnel.
